This is a great book, although before you get started with this one, I would recommend this other one for a quick hands-on intro to compilers and interpreters: "Writing Compilers and Interpreters: A Software Engineering Approach, 3rd Edition," by Ronald Mak. If you've never had much guidance on the subject, writing a compiler for "The Elements of computing systems" could take an unnecessarily long amount of time your first time. Mak's book is in Java, which might be a plus in your case.
